diff options
author | Daniel Willmann <dwillmann@sysmocom.de> | 2021-01-17 14:20:28 +0100 |
---|---|---|
committer | Daniel Willmann <dwillmann@sysmocom.de> | 2021-01-17 14:20:28 +0100 |
commit | 89a00f352de6b41b53887f5b08eb9bd41c95b908 (patch) | |
tree | 80ff8e4f4d5b6a9dfd8d6abea3ada598c4d80def | |
parent | cf8371ad4d2eb0f77556cff710d514004fb00277 (diff) |
ns2: Fix memory leak in IP-SNS
Don't allocate msg twice - it's not nice.
Change-Id: I3fa0076eb480a7bcadb74cc86760dc29b77ac600
Related: OS#4874
-rw-r--r-- | src/gb/gprs_ns2_message.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/src/gb/gprs_ns2_message.c b/src/gb/gprs_ns2_message.c index eb9a1984..6c7f08fd 100644 --- a/src/gb/gprs_ns2_message.c +++ b/src/gb/gprs_ns2_message.c @@ -498,7 +498,7 @@ int ns2_tx_sns_ack(struct gprs_ns2_vc *nsvc, uint8_t trans_id, uint8_t *cause, const struct gprs_ns_ie_ip6_elem *ip6_elems, unsigned int num_ip6_elems) { - struct msgb *msg = gprs_ns2_msgb_alloc(); + struct msgb *msg; struct gprs_ns_hdr *nsh; uint16_t nsei; @@ -652,7 +652,7 @@ int ns2_tx_sns_config_ack(struct gprs_ns2_vc *nsvc, uint8_t *cause) int ns2_tx_sns_size(struct gprs_ns2_vc *nsvc, bool reset_flag, uint16_t max_nr_nsvc, int ip4_ep_nr, int ip6_ep_nr) { - struct msgb *msg = gprs_ns2_msgb_alloc(); + struct msgb *msg; struct gprs_ns_hdr *nsh; uint16_t nsei; |